File AvailableSoubeiran, J.L.; Thiersant, D. de 1874 La matiere medicale chez les Chinois. Paris, G. Masson, pp. i-x, 1-319
Location:
Subject:
Species:
Asia - East Asia - China
Value - Related to Horn
All Rhino Species
The horns, si koh, are used to make vases (cups?), and are used as medicine for a variety of diseases. The hide, si p'i, is used to make a gell, bai-si-kau, which is much esteemed. They also male a good gelatine, sy-kio, from the feet of the rhinoceros. They also take scraping from the bones, ...

File AvailableWilliams, S.W. 1856 Chinese commercial guide, consisting of a collection of details and regulations respecting foreign trade with China, sailing directions, tables &c., 4th edition (revised and enlarged). Canton, Office of the Chinese Repository, pp. i-viii, 1-376
Location:
Subject:
Species:
Asia - East Asia - China
Value - Related to Horn
Asian Rhino Species
1856, China, best horns $300 per piece, inferior grade from $30 upwards
